What is BS EN IEC 62668 ‑ 2 – Counterfeit prevention in electronic components about?
BS EN IEC 62668 is a series of the international standard on process management for avionics that specifies the intellectual property (IP) which results in preventing counterfeit activities.
BS EN IEC 62668-2 is the second part of an international standard on process management for avionics which results in preventing counterfeit, fraudulent or recycling activities while purchasing the components from non-franchised sources.
BS EN IEC 62668 ‑ 2 defines requirements for avoiding the use of counterfeit, recycled and fraudulent components when these components are not purchased from the original component manufacturer (OCM) or are purchased from outside of franchised distributor networks for use in the aerospace, defence and high performance (ADHP) industries.
This practice is used, as derogation, only when there are no reasonable or practical alternatives.
